哎,谁没遇到过在云服务器上搞FTP传文件,结果刚开始飞快上传,结果五秒不到,“啪”的一声,连接就断了?这种情况简直比买咖啡还快,煎熬得人直想踢飞服务器。今天咱们就扒一扒这个“迅雷不及掩耳”的奇景背后隐藏的秘密,告诉你怎么搞定这个五秒掉线怪现象,让你的云端操作不再像赶乌龟一样慢吞吞。
第一:了解云服务器的网络配置。很多时候,FTP掉线不是偶然,而是“内在”的问题。有时候网络设置被VPC(虚拟私有云)或者安全组限制了,防火墙规则筛掉了FTP的数据包。比如,端口21或被动模式所用的端口范围没有开放,404不是只有网页的问题,云端的防火墙一看“这个端口不在允许范围”,立马冰封。是不是很像国内网的限速?别担心,调整安全组设置,开放FTP所需端口, Basic的事一句话解决,操作起来像拼拼图一样简单。
第二:检查云服务器的资源使用情况。CPU、内存、磁盘IO是不是处于高峰?云平台的监控面板请你确认一下。如果服务器因为“吃胖”或“加班”导致资源紧张,那连接自然时好时坏,尤其是在高峰时段,数据传输犹如堵车。连接断线很可能就是“物理”原因,让你以为是网络不稳定,其实是服务器“偷懒”了。此时可以考虑升级云服务器配置,或者合理调度资源,像搭积木一样把握住每个“砖头”。
第三:网络延迟和包丢失问题。云服务的网络像个大嘴巴,有时候包包被打包得稀巴烂,丢包率一高,FTP连接就像喝了“塑料袋”,一阵阵掉线。长时间运行后,网络的稳定性会受到影响,要用ping命令检测网速、丢包情况。遇到严重丢包,可以考虑更换网络运营商,或者使用VPN优化网络路径。有些云服务商会提供专线服务,连接更稳定,测试后好比打了“稳定剂”。
第四:FTP客户端配置问题。别小看客户端的设置,特别是在被动和主动模式切换之间,可能引发“断线魔咒”。比如:被动模式(PASV)需要确保云服务器上的被动端口范围也已开放,否则很可能一退出就“送回家”。此外,连接超时时间太短也会引发掉线,中途不耐烦的等待,FTP就自己跑掉。建议调整超时参数,像调节闹钟那样精准,避免“挂在半空”。
第五:云服务器的防火墙和安全组配置。这里要点火锅!防火墙设置如果一不小心,把FTP用到的被动端口范围封堵掉了,连接自然断裂。开启防火墙规则时,记得把端口范围设置好,比如:被动端口80-90一起放开,配置得像五环一样严谨,才能确保“包裹”畅通无阻。还有一点,确认SELinux或者AppArmor没有堵住FTP的“后路”。
再说一句,网络中个别“黑暗角落”隐藏的原因也不少,比如:云平台某些策略限制了长连接,会导致FTP掉线。其实,很多问题都“藏”在配置或环境中,不耐烦一查,难以见识“真相”。别忘了,如果你觉得这些操作太复杂,或者没有时间调整,不妨试试各种工具,比如专业的FTP监控软件,帮你监控连接状态,通知你什么时候掉线,及时修复。)
嘿,顺便说一句,如果你平时爱玩游戏又想挣点零花钱,别忘了去【bbs.77.ink】看看,玩游戏还能赚零花,边玩边赚不是梦!
最后,当你调试完所有参数,重启一下云服务器,像给自己加个“鸡血”一样,通常问题就会神奇地得到解决。看似“神操作”的那些技术细节,实际上就是把收集到的“蛛丝马迹”整合起来,像拼图一样拼出“完美方案”。关注每一个细节,用心打理云端的FTP连接,五秒掉线会变成五百秒的“童话故事”。